Cable Tray Technical Guide A practical guide to product selection

Cable tray length is selected based on the load to be supported, the distance between the supports (also referred to as the span), and handling and installation constraints.

The Comprehensive Guide to Cable Tray Systems: Engineering,

A cable tray does not simply consist of a long, straight length of metal. In order to turn corners or climb walls, you require corresponding components such as tees and elbows.
